It's that time of the year again when the iconic Super GT from Japan makes its annual appearance at the Sepang International Circuit.
Scheduled for the weekend of 20 and 21 June, this super-exciting race series made its first visit to Malaysia back in 2000.
Famed for its super-modified and colouful racecars - and its gorgeous race queens, it is a hit with the hundreds (even thousands) of Singaporeans who visit the race every year.
The racecars are divided into two main categories - GT300 and GT500 - the numbers referring to the maximum power outputs allowable. And what an assortment of cars there are!

And a very unique car - the Toyota Corolla Axio.
Not this one - this is the boring roadcar version.
But this one and yes, your eyes do not deceive you, it is an Axio and it is fielded by Team apr.
Powered by a detuned version of the engine found in the Lexus IS350, it shows off the expertise of Japanese tuners.
